🚨 GitHub 监控消息提醒 🚨发现关键词:#漏洞#检测#分析 📦项目名称:Open-Audit 👤项目作者:elegent-administrator 🛠开发语言: Python ⭐Star数量: 0 | 🍴Fork数量: 0 📅更新时间: 2026-05-16 03:56:40 📝项目描述: Open Audit是面向企业研发、开发者群体的AI智能明文代码安全审计工具,基于Python语言开发、FastCGI架构搭建,融合Semgrep工具链与自主研发的AI Agent,精准匹配数字时代代码安全审计的市场核心需求。工具直击行业传统审计工具误报率高、扩展能力弱、无法检测逻辑漏洞三大痛点,通过AI Agent深度分析漏洞代码上下文实现误报过滤,开放标准化接口支持企业自定义扩展漏洞检测方向,依托Agent的逻辑推理能力突破常规工具技术瓶颈,实现逻辑漏洞精准审计,同时完成跨平台适配,为中小微企业、互联网研发团队、个人开发者提供高效、可定制、高精准的代码安全审计解决方案,全方位筑牢代码研发安全防线。 🔗点击访问项目地址

Difference Between “drop out” and “be dropped out” Many people make this mistake: ❌ I was dropped out This sentence is grammatically incorrect. The correct structure is: ✅ I dropped out. Meaning: I voluntarily left or withdrew from school/university. Why “was dropped out” is wrong “Drop out” is an intransitive verb. It does not take an object, so it cannot be used in the passive voice. ❌ You cannot say: I was dropped out of university. Because dropping out is something you do yourself. Correct Usage If it was your decision: I dropped out of university. If it wasn’t your decision: Use other verbs to express that: I was expelled from university. I was forced to leave university. @fluencyinenglish #EnglishGrammar#GrammarTips#DropOut#PassiveVoice#IntransitiveVerbs#IELTSGrammar#CommonMistakes#LearnEnglish#TEFL
